Who was Bohumil Mořkovský?
Bohumil Mořkovský was a Czech gymnast who competed for Czechoslovakia in the 1924 Summer Olympics.
He was born and died in Valašské Meziříčí, Moravia.
In 1924 he won a bronze medal in the vault competition.
At the 1924 Summer Olympics he also participated in the following events:
Rings - sixth place
Individual all-around - 13th place
Parallel bars - 13th place
Rope climbing - 18th place
Sidehorse vault - 23rd place
Pommel horse - 31st place
Horizontal bar - 41st place
Team all-around - did not finish
